Abstract

This research aimed to conduct an analytical study of the content of primary school science curricula in light of scientific and engineering practices of the next generation of science standards. To achieve this goal, qualitative data were collected using the descriptive approach using a content analysis tool for primary school science books in its three grades and two semesters. The analysis sample consisted of books in light of the next generation science standards in its three dimensions. The study concluded that the percentage of inclusion of these dimensions is low; Where the most common concepts are represented in the content with an inclusion rate of (67.45), and came second after the central ideas with an inclusion rate of (46.37%), and came third after scientific and engineering practices with a low rate of (34). Within the framework of the analysis results, the current research recommends developing science curricula for the primary stage in light of the next generation science standards and including its three dimensions in the academic content.
